Note: The job is a remote job and is open to candidates in USA. VectorShift is a company that provides tooling to create custom AI workflows quickly. The QA Engineer will be responsible for ensuring the quality of software products through meticulous manual testing, collaborating with developers and product managers to identify defects and verify functionality. Responsibilities **Test Planning and Design**: Create detailed, comprehensive, and well-structured test plans and test cases based on product requirements and specifications **Manual Testing**: Execute manual test cases to verify the functionality, usability, and performance of software applications across various platforms and devices **Defect Identification and Reporting**: Identify, document, and track defects using bug-tracking tools (e.g., Jira, Linear), providing clear and detailed reproduction steps **Collaboration**: Work closely with developers and product managers to understand requirements, provide feedback, and ensure defects are resolved effectively **Regression Testing**: Perform regression testing to ensure new changes do not negatively impact existing functionality **User Acceptance Testing**: Support user acceptance testing (UAT) by preparing test scenarios and assisting end-users during testing phases **Documentation**: Maintain accurate and up-to-date test documentation, including test cases, test results, and defect reports **Quality Advocacy**: Advocate for quality throughout the software development lifecycle, ensuring adherence to best practices and standards Skills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Information Technology, or a related field (or equivalent experience) Strong understanding of software testing methodologies, including functional, regression, and exploratory testing Familiarity with bug-tracking tools (e.g., Jira, Bugzilla) Basic knowledge of software development processes Excellent attention to detail and problem-solving skills Strong communication skills to articulate defects and collaborate with cross-functional teams Ability to work independently and manage multiple priorities in a fast-paced environment Experience testing web and/or mobile applications Familiarity with basic scripting or automation tools (e.g., Selenium, Postman) is a plus but not required Knowledge of SQL for database testing is an advantage Company Overview VectorShift Builds, designs, prototypes, and deploys custom generative AI workflows.
